Fear-Less Triple P program

 for assistance with managing anxieties 

 

Coming to the end of the year, we know that anxiety can be seen kicking in for some students (and families!). The Federal Australian Government has now fully funded the Fear-Less Triple P program online, to support parents. 

 

Triple P is one of the few parenting programs in the world with evidence to show it works. There are (literally hundreds of) trials and studies to show Triple P works for most families, in many different cultures, and in many different family situations. Triple P Online is also the first online parenting program proven to work. The program is focused on helping parents to learn a variety of cognitive behavioural strategies for anxiety management, encouraging them to apply these themselves for all their children. It is a useful tool for engaging parents (or caregivers) of children with anxiety aged from 6 to 14 years.

 

WHAT IS COVERED IN THE SESSIONS?

Session 1: Anxiety – what is it and how does it develop?

Session 2: Promoting emotional resilience in children

Session 3: Encouraging realistic thinking

Session 4: Understanding avoidance

Session 5: Parental strategies for responding to children’s anxiety

Session 6: Constructive problem solving – how to promote it and maintain gains

 

HOW LONG DOES IT TAKE?

The Fear-Less Triple P Online course has 6 modules. Each module of the Triple P Online Course only takes about 30 minutes to an hour. You don’t need to do it all in one block, either. Some people prefer to just do ten or fifteen minutes a day.
